Journaling: Based upon Renoir’s painting, “Dance at Bougival”, J. Seward Johnson’s sculpture allows us to take a “turn” around the floor with the dancing couple. The detail he puts into his work extends even to the violet nosegay tossed to one side. This is part of the “Crossing Paths” public art exhibit on the campus of the University of Florida. 7-23-11
